8-K: Enviri Corporation Reports Strong Q4 and Full Year 2023 Results, Exceeds Guidance

Summary

  • Enviri Corporation reported its fourth quarter and full year 2023 financial results, showing significant improvements.
  • Fourth-quarter revenue from continuing operations reached $529 million, a 13% increase compared to the same period last year.
  • GAAP operating income for Q4 was $28 million, a substantial increase from $2 million in the prior year.
  • Adjusted EBITDA for Q4 totaled $73 million, a 21% increase year-over-year and exceeding the company's guidance range of $62 million to $69 million.
  • Full-year 2023 revenue from continuing operations increased by 10% to $2.07 billion.
  • Full-year GAAP operating income was $111 million, a significant turnaround from a $57 million loss in 2022.
  • Adjusted EBITDA for the full year reached $293 million, a 28% increase compared to the previous year.
  • The company's credit agreement net leverage ratio declined to 4.1x at the end of the quarter.
  • For 2024, Enviri expects adjusted EBITDA to increase to between $300 million and $320 million.

Positives

  • Both Clean Earth and Harsco Environmental segments experienced revenue growth due to higher service demand and pricing.
  • The company achieved significant improvements in operating income and adjusted EBITDA for both the quarter and the full year.
  • Enviri's free cash flow, excluding Rail, improved to $25 million in Q4 2023, compared to $3 million in the prior year.
  • The company expects to maintain strong business momentum and further improve operating results in 2024.
  • Enviri is optimistic about its growth potential and the value within each of its businesses.
  • The company is actively working to strengthen and sell its Rail business.

Negatives

  • The company reported a GAAP diluted loss per share from continuing operations of $0.17 for Q4 2023.
  • The adjusted diluted loss per share from continuing operations was $0.07 for Q4 2023.
  • Full-year 2023 GAAP diluted loss per share from continuing operations was $0.57.
  • Full-year 2023 adjusted diluted loss per share from continuing operations was $0.12.
  • Full-year free cash flow (excluding Rail) was $24 million in 2023, compared with $75 million in the prior year, due to the accounts receivable securitization program and higher cash interest payments.

Management Comments

  • Enviri had a strong 2023, finishing the year with solid quarterly results and significant momentum in both Clean Earth and Harsco Environmental, said Enviri Chairman and CEO Nick Grasberger.
  • Our results benefited from healthy end-market demand and continuing operational excellence across our businesses.
  • The earnings growth in both the quarter and full year was supported by efficiency and growth initiatives and pricing actions implemented across the Company.
  • Looking forward, we expect to maintain our strong business momentum and that our operating results will improve further in 2024, with Clean Earth again leading the way.
  • We also expect to further improve our debt leverage position in 2024.
  • We remain optimistic about Enviris growth potential and the value within each of our businesses, and we will continue to deliver on our strategic priorities to create value for shareholders in the coming years.
